Old coloured map of the counties of Gloucestershire and Monmouthshire from Jansson’s atlas of the world “Novus Atlas”, Volume IV containing the English county maps, first published in 1646. The map contains the usual Jansson decorations; including coats of arms of the noble families of the counties and a scenes of local life adorned with putti. A description of the counties appears on the verso in Dutch. The map has a professionally repaired centrefold split; otherwise, a finely coloured, strong dark impression on heavy paper in very good condition. 40.5 cm x 51 cm
